Spécificités
Sensor | |
Effective Pixels | 21 megapixels |
Sensor Size | APS-C (23.5 x 15.7 mm) |
Max resolution | 5568 x 3712 |
Sensor Type | CMOS |
Image | |
ISO | Auto, 100-51200 (expands to 204,800) |
Custom white balance | Yes |
Image stabilization | No |
Uncompressed format | RAW |
JPEG quality levels | Fine, normal, basic |
Lens and Focus | |
Number of focus points | 209 |
Manual focus | Yes |
Lens mount | Nikon Z |
Screen/Viewfinder | |
LCD type | Tilting |
Screen size | 3.2″ |
Screen dots | 1040000 |
Touch screen | Yes |
Screen type | TFT LCD |
Live view | Yes |
Viewfinder type | Electronic |
Viewfinder coverage | 100% |
Viewfinder magnification | 1.02× (0.68× 35mm equiv.) |
Viewfinder resolution | 2360000 |
Shooting Control | |
Minimum shutter speed | 30 sec |
Maximum shutter speed | 1/4000 sec |
Built-in flash | Yes |
External flash | Yes (via hot shoe) |
Continuous Shooting | 11.0 fps |
Exposure compensation | ±5 (at 1/3 EV, 1/2 EV steps) |
AE Bracketing | ±5 (2, 3, 5, 7 frames at 1/3 EV, 1/2 EV, 2/3 EV, 1 EV steps) |
WB Bracketing | Yes |
Video | |
Video Format | MPEG-4, H.264 |
Microphone | Stereo |
Speaker | Mono |
Storage and Connectivity | |
Storage types | SD/SDHC/SDXC card (UHS-II supported) |
USB | USB 2.0 (480 Mbit/sec) |
USB charging | Yes |
HDMI | Yes (micro HDMI) |
Microphone port | Yes |
Headphone port | No |
Wireless | Built-In |
Remote control | Yes (via smartphone) |
Body and Battery | |
Battery description | EN-EL25 lithium-ion battery & charger |
Battery Life (CIPA) | 320 |
Weight (inc. batteries) | 450 g (0.99 lb / 15.87 oz) |
Dimensions | 127 x 94 x 60 mm (5 x 3.7 x 2.36″) |
Description
The Nikon Z50 is a compact mirrorless camera with an APS-C sensor (known as DX-format in Nikon-speak) that uses the company's Z-mount. It uses a 20.9MP BSI CMOS sensor (derived from the D500's) with on-sensor phase detection, but not in-body image stabilization like the full-frame Z6 and Z7. The lightweight Z50 has a touchscreen that tilts downward and a 2.36M-dot OLED viewfinder. It supports face and eye detection, and the Z50 can shoot continuously at 11 fps with continuous AF. The camera can record 4K/30p video, albeit with a 1.5x crop. It has numerous special effects that can be used for both stills and video. The Z50's connectivity includes Wi-Fi and Bluetooth.
